With his cheerful and carefree disposition, Arjun Kapoor is not only a hit with the ladies, but is also one of the few Bollywood actors, who has many close friends within the fraternity.

‘I’M EVERYBODY’S FRIEND’

Among the current crop of actors, apart from Varun Dhawan and Ranbir Kapoor, Arjun also shares a good rapport with Tiger Shroff. He exclaims, “I’m everybody’s friend. The other day, I met Tiger. I was happy to see him. When I saw his debut film Heropanti (2014), I felt this guy had something to make it big.” 

He adds that rather than competing with each other, one should make the most of being in Bollywood. The Namaste England actor elaborates, “We’re fortunate to be in this industry, people want to be in our position. So, why have any negativity? Sabki filmein chale, hamari thodi zyada chale… We should celebrate that we’re one fraternity. When we can get together when there is a need, why can’t we do so when there is no need? The negativity comes from external factors.”

‘I’M NOT SELFISH’

The actor admits that as he has grown up in the industry, his friends are largely from it. He states, “My friendship with Ranveer began during Gunday (2014) and our bond has strengthened over the years.” The two fondly call each other Baba. He adds, “Varun and I did our acting classes together. I got along with Alia (Bhatt) fantastically during and after 2 States (2014). With Priyanka (Chopra), I can sit and have a conversation about anything. I don’t see any reason to be concerned why I am friends with them, or maybe I should have pals from outside the industry. Kaunsi insecurity hai that two heroes can’t be friends. We support each other. I can think like that because I’m not selfish.”

‘I NEED SOME MORE TIME TO SETTLE DOWN’

Quiz him about factoring in dates to attend his Gunday co-star Priyanka’s marriage and he answers, “Unfortunately, I couldn’t go for Priyanka’s (engagement) party as I was shooting that time. But I told her I was very happy for her. I hope she has an amazing life with Nick (Jonas).”

Ask him about his Baba (Ranveer) tying the knot with Deepika Padukone this November and he jokes, “I don’t know about that Baba (Ranveer) and I don’t know about this Baba (referring to himself). I think Baba and Baba are married to each other (laughs). Hum dono ki shaadi ho chuki hai.”

That brings us to the question of his marriage to which Arjun replies candidly, “I haven’t thought about my wedding. There is Anshula and Rhea. We just had two weddings in the family. Between Mohit’s (cousin Mohit Marwah) and Sonam’s (Kapoor, now Ahuja) nuptials, the designers have run out of creativity. Let’s give them some time and a new season to come up with new collections.”

“I’d like to make sure Anshula is married before I take the plunge, it would make me a calmer person to see her settled. I’m 33, I still need some more time before settling down,” the doting brother says.

‘I CAN TAKE PARINEETI FOR GRANTED’

Talking about his first co-star Parineeti Chopra with whom he will be seen next in Namaste England and Sandeep Aur Pinky Faraar (SAPF), he maintains, “She is very fortunate to have me in her life. She should thank her stars (laughs). Jokes apart, we started off hating each other during the workshops of our debut film, Ishaqzaade (2012). Then, we realised that we had to look out for each other otherwise hum barbaad ho jayenge. That’s how our friendship started. Everything around us has changed whether it’s people or life in general, but even today when I meet her, there’s the same energy on the set. On the first day of SAPF, we picked up things exactly from where we had left off on the last day of Ishaqzaade. I can take her for granted. We share a certain ease, I hope it continues as that’s rare in this profession.”
